Security and Fair Play

Security is a top priority for any serious online casino. Legitimate sites employ SSL encryption to safeguard personal and financial information. They also use random number generators (RNGs) to ensure that casino games are fair and outcomes are unpredictable. Players should avoid platforms that lack clear security protocols or have a history of player complaints. For USA online gambling, checking if a casino is licensed by a reputable jurisdiction adds an extra layer of trust.

Legal Considerations

While USA online gambling is legal in several states, regulations vary by location. Players must ensure they only use platforms licensed to operate in their state. Federal laws like the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A) prohibit financial institutions from processing transactions related to unregulated online gambling. However, many states have enacted their own laws to allow licensed online casinos. Always research local regulations before signing up for a new account.

Responsible Gambling Tips

  • Set Limits: Use the deposit and spending limits available on most online casinos to control your gambling activity.
  • Take Breaks: Avoid prolonged sessions by setting time limits and stepping away when needed.
  • Seek Help: If gambling becomes a problem, contact organizations like the National Council on Problem Gambling for support.
